The City of Prince George and the Ministry of Healthy Living and Sport are proud to announce the opening of the new ActNow BC Senior’s Community Park that brings the gym to the great outdoors!

“I am glad to see our province and our City investing in the health and wellness of older adults and the Senior’s Community Park is a great start”, Sharon Hurd, President, Prince George Council of Seniors.

ActNow BC Senior’s Community Park is a state-of-the-art outdoor facility located on Massey Drive, adjacent to Masich Place Stadium. The fitness stations are designed for Senior’s and are a compliment to the walking opportunities at the Masich Place Stadium Track

The fitness equipment emphasizes flexibility and strength-building, using isometric exercises to strengthen muscles and increase stamina and balance. The circuit is designed for all levels of users, from the beginner to advanced, and each station offers varying levels of difficulty.

Benefits to Seniors

Increased muscle strength & endurance
Increased core strength
Increased flexibility
Improved ability to perform daily tasks
Improved quality of life
Weight-bearing exercise combats risk of osteoporosis
Cardiovascular fitness
Psychological benefits
Social benefits

The park is always open and is free for all to enjoy.  Stay in shape or start a new routine!
